For My Brother

A project in San Francisco, CA by Crooked Tree Studios
000days 
:
00hours 
:
00minutes 

Cancelled by Creator

A story of becoming a monster to protect someone you love.
Backers: 665
Average Pledge Per Backer: $47

Funded: $31,405 of $150,000
Dates: Jun 18th -> Jul 22nd (34 days)
Project By: Crooked Tree Studios

Psychic Truck Throwing Developers Return With A Touching Story

June 19th - via: cliqist.com
From the creators of Throw Trucks With Your Mind, Crooked Tree Studios, comes their second Kickstarter-based game, For My Brother. In For My Brother, you’re a sister with quite the dilemma. In order to save the life of the brother you hold dear, you must transform into a monster of some sort. Downside is the more time spent turning into said monster, the more he drifts away from you. (Read More)
